NAME

       fc-conflist - list the configuration files processed by Fontconfig

SYNOPSIS

       fc-conflist [ -Vh ]

        [ --version ]  [ --help ]

DESCRIPTION

       fc-conflist prints an annotated list of all the configuration files processed by Fontconfig.

       The  output  is  a  `-' or `+' depending on whether the file is ignored or processed, a space, the file's
       path, a colon and space, and the description from the file or `No description' if none is present.

       The order of files looks like how fontconfig  actually  processes  them  except  one  contains  <include>
       element.   In  that  case, it will be shown after processing all the sub directories where is targeted by
       <include>.

OPTIONS

       This program follows the usual GNU command line syntax, with long options starting with two dashes (`-').
       A summary of options is included below.

       -V     Show version of the program and exit.

       -h     Show summary of options.

RETURN CODES

       fc-conflist returns error code 0 for successful parsing, or 1 if any errors occurred or if at  least  one
       font face could not be opened.
